2024 Compare Cities Education:
Los Lunas, NM vs Albuquerque, NM

Change Cities
Highlights
- Albuquerque spends 11.5% more per student than Los Lunas.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 20.7% lower in Albuquerque than in Los Lunas.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Albuquerque had 2.2% more residents who had graduated High School compared to Los Lunas
